The city boasts several hospitals, including Bridgeport Hospital and St. Vincent's Medical Center, both of which provide comprehensive medical services ranging from emergency care to specialized treatment options. Additionally, there are numerous clinics and primary care physicians located throughout the city, ensuring that residents have convenient access to routine healthcare services.
One unique local health initiative in Bridgeport is the Southwest Community Health Center, which provides affordable and accessible healthcare services to underserved populations. This community-focused facility offers a wide range of medical and dental services, catering to individuals and families who may face barriers to accessing traditional healthcare providers.
